Kamionki
Kamionki is a Polish place name:
- in the Warmian-Masurian Voivodeship:
- Kamionki (Giżycko) , village in the Giżycki powiat, until 1928: Kamionken , 1928 to 1945 Steintal , Lötzen district, East Prussia
- Kamionki (Gołdap) , village in the Gołdapski powiat, until 1938: Kaminonken , 1938 to 1945 Eichicht , Goldap district, East Prussia
- Kamionki (Kozłowo) , village in the powiat Nidzicki, nobleman Kamionken until 1932 , Steintal from 1932 to 1945 , Neidenburg district, East Prussia
- Other voivodeships:
- Kamionki (Kórnik) , village in the Greater Poland Voivodeship , before 1879 Kamionek , 11879 to 1919 and 1939 to 1945 Steindorf , Poznan County, Poznan
- Kamionki (Łącna) , village in the Świętokrzyskie Voivodeship
- Kamionki (Stara Biała) , village in the Masovian Voivodeship
- Kamionki (Pieszyce) , village in the province of Lower Silesia , until 1945 Stone Kunz village , district Reichenbach, Silesia
- Kamionki (Nowa Karczma) , village in the province of Pomerania , before 1945 small fireplace , Circle Stuhm, West Prussia
- Kamionki (Kołbaskowo) , village in the West Pomeranian Voivodeship , until 1945 Unter Schöningen , Randow / Greifenhagen district, Pomerania
